The government’s anti-hate bill, which provoked a bitter parliamentary battle with the Conservatives about whether it threatens religious freedom, cleared its final parliamentary stage on Wednesday and is poised to become law.
The new law, due to gain royal assent within days, would make it a crime punishable by up to 10 years in prison to obstruct someone from accessing a place of worship or other sites where Jews, Muslims and other identifiable groups gather.
The bill also criminalizes the willful promotion of hatred toward religious and ethnic groups by publicly displaying terror or hate symbols.
